Premodern narratives create a multiplicity of meaning by juxtaposing principal, paratextual, and structural dimensions. Print publishers and others involved in transmission would vary the semantic meaning of works such as "Fortunatus" and "Herzog Ernst." Using manuscripts and printed versions from the 15th to the 19th century, this volume seeks to interpret early modern German prose novels in accordance with the conditions of their transmission.
